Ball milling: the behavior of graphite as a function of ...
01/01/2002· The ball milling of graphite in the presence of a liquid leads to very thin, well crystallized and anisometric particles. In the presence of water, the graphite particles are covered by γ Fe 2 O 3 formed by the oxidation of the ferrous alloy coming from the milling tools. This composite presents interesting electrochemical properties.
Ball milling of graphite and muilti wall carbon nanotubes
The ball milling of graphite and MWCNTs with liquid additives reduced the agglomeration of MWCNT and transformed graphite to graphenes. The ball milling of MWCNTs under impact mode usually resulted in the formation of an amorphous phase, whereas that under friction mode induced the fattening of nanotubes.
